您好,登錄后才能下訂單哦!
在Haskell中開發云原生應用可以利用一些工具和最佳實踐來提高開發效率和可維護性。一些常見的支持和最佳實踐包括:
使用Haskell的包管理工具如cabal或stack來管理依賴和構建項目。這些工具可以幫助你管理項目的依賴關系,并確保所有依賴項的版本都能正確解析和構建。
使用Haskell的Web框架如Yesod,Servant或Scotty來構建服務端應用程序。這些框架提供了一些常用的功能和工具,如路由、請求處理、中間件等,可以幫助你快速搭建應用程序。
使用Haskell的數據庫庫如persistent或beam來訪問數據庫。這些庫提供了類型安全的數據庫訪問接口,可以幫助你避免一些常見的數據庫錯誤。
使用一些常用的云原生工具如Docker和Kubernetes來部署和管理你的應用程序。這些工具可以幫助你將應用程序打包成容器,并在云上部署和擴展。
使用一些測試框架如Hspec或QuickCheck來編寫測試用例。測試是保證應用程序質量的一個重要環節,可以幫助你發現和修復潛在的問題。
總的來說,使用這些工具和最佳實踐可以幫助你更輕松地開發和維護云原生應用,并確保應用程序的質量和可靠性。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。